class文件是Java编译器编译Java源代码后生成的二进制字节码文件。这个字节码文件可以被Java虚拟机(JVM)加载和执行。Java源代码被编译成class文件,可以在任何平台上运行,只要有安装了JVM的平台上就可以运行。class文件包含了Java程序的所有信息,包括类的结构、方法、变量等等。当Java程序需要被执行时,JVM会加载相应的class文件,并执行其中的代码。
class文件是二进制文件,不能直接使用文本编辑器打开。但是,你可以使用一些特殊的工具来打开和查看class文件。以下是一些打开class文件的方法:
1、使用反编译工具:你可以使用反编译工具,如JD-GUI、Jad等,将class文件反编译为Java源代码,并查看反编译后的代码。
2、使用Java虚拟机工具:Java虚拟机提供了一些工具,如javap、jdb等,可以用来查看class文件的内容和调试Java程序。
3、使用IDE工具:Java开发工具,如Eclipse、IntelliJ IDEA等,可以打开和查看class文件。你可以将class文件拖到项目中,然后用IDE打开。
请注意,反编译class文件可能会侵犯版权问题,请确保你有权进行反编译操作。